    In terms of this one game, I feel the players gave everything. Some were not at their top level, and we could have used some smarter decisions in the final third, but in general, they played well and weren't afraid of Bayern like in past games.

    Agreed that the season was lost before this game. This game was a remote chance to regain it, but it didn't happen.

    The good news is that I don't think there is any reason now to keep Favre. He's good with all the preparations and tactics that happen before the game, but he sucks for the 90 minutes of the game. I don't think that cuts it.

    Player wise..

    I thought Dahoud and Delaney performed great given that their like 3rd and 4th in line in this center mid positions. They were so confident on the ball.

    Brandt was good. The only reason I could imagine he was subbed is that he was running too much. But I would have kept him for 10 more minutes.

    Hakimi and Sancho --our most talented-- were a bit underwhelming. Although I disagree with @Oliseh that this signals that Sancho's leaving. I think he'll realize that BVB is the best place for him next season.

    Defense stood out. Great performance by the 3 CBs. Guerreiro good game as well.

    Gotze... he's bad AND he's rusty. That ball he got in the box, while facing the goal, no one around him, at pace.. it's just instinct to put your foot in it and direct it to goal. Instead he passes it back :| Good luck in his next club!
